Web27 jan. 2024 · The poem is about a blind boy. He does not know what is light. He cannot see the bright sun, but he can feel its warmth. When he plays, it is day for him. When he sleeps it is night for him. The boy has a lot of patience. He is still happy but a poor blind boy. 2. Pick out the rhyming words in the poem. Also, coin some of your own rhyming words. Web14 jan. 2024 · And now dear little children, who may this story read, To idle, silly flattering words, I pray you ne ’er give heed: Question (a). Who does ‘I’ refer to? Answer: I refers to the poet. Question (b). What is the advice given to the readers? Answer: The poet advises us not to fall a prey to flattery and sweet words.
